Somalia Gets a Tourist, Mogadishu Officials Are Baffled: This is not an Onion article.
“We have never seen people like this man,” Omar Mohamed, one of the officials, told the AFP. “He said he was a tourist, we couldn’t believe him. But later on we found he was serious. That makes him the first person to come to Mogadishu only for tourism.” [...]
Bown managed to spend time in the dangerous capital (only within the gates of his heavily guarded hotel), though he said that it took a bit of finagling to actually get past the dubious officials at the airport.
“They tried four times to put me back on the plane to get rid of me but I shouted and played tricks until the plane left without me,” he said.
